The Attack and Its Aftermath

Russia's recent assault on Ukraine's capital, Kyiv, was the most intense since the full-scale invasion began over four years ago. The attack, which involved ballistic and cruise missiles, as well as drones, resulted in at least 21 fatalities and numerous injuries. The city's infrastructure and residential areas bore the brunt of the damage, with buildings reduced to rubble and residents seeking shelter in metro stations and other safe havens.

Russia's Justification and Ukraine's Response

Russia's Defense Ministry claimed the strike targeted military plants, a narrative that Ukraine's Foreign Minister, Andrii Sybiha, strongly refuted. Sybiha emphasized Ukraine's right to self-defense under international law, while condemning Russia's aggression.

The Role of International Support

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y has been vocal about the need for increased support from Ukraine's partners, particularly in the form of air defense systems. He believes that the political debates and internal questions within supporting countries are hindering the timely delivery of much-needed resources.

The Bigger Picture

The attack on Kyiv is not an isolated incident but rather a part of a larger trend of intensified Russian aggression. As Ukraine's long-range drone campaign has caused disruptions within Russia, Moscow has responded with a series of attacks on Ukrainian cities, including Kyiv.
